Design
The XPS 15 (9560) is the latest iteration of Dell’s higher-end mainstream laptop. As such, it packs quite a punch when it comes to specs and features, yet it’s still relatively portable and light for a 15-inch notebook. This year’s model is a refinement of last year’s, with a few key changes that include:
-A thinner and lighter aluminum chassis that’s just 0.45 inches (11.4mm) at its thickest point and weighs 4 pounds (1.8kg).
-A choice of either a 1080p or 4K (UHD) display, both with Dell’s excellent InfinityEdge bezels that allow for an 80 percent screen-to-body ratio.
-New CPU options that include Intel’s 8th-generation quad-core processors, which should provide a big performance boost over the previous generation.
-GPU options now include Nvidia’s GTX 1050 Ti, which should offer significant gaming and multimedia performance improvements over the GTX 960M in 2016’s model.
-The battery has been increased to 97WHr, up from 84WHr last year, for even longer endurance between charges.
Display
The display on the Dell XPS 15 is simply stunning. It’s a 4K Ultra HD (3,840 x 2,160) InfinityEdge touch display, and it looks fantastic. The bezels are incredibly thin, and the panel itself is bright and vibrant. It’s a true work of art, and it’s one of the best displays I’ve ever seen on a laptop.

Battery Life
The Dell XPS 15 is a great laptop for power users, but one of its major selling points is its long battery life. In our testing, the XPS 15 lasted for more than 12 hours on a single charge. With light usage, you can easily get a full day of work out of this laptop. However, if you’re planning on using the XPS 15 for more demanding tasks, you’ll want to make sure you have a charger handy.
